| 2 | miR-145 improves metabolic inflammatory disease through multiple pathways显示文摘Chronic inflammation plays a pivotal role in insulin resistance and type 2 diabetes,yet the mechanisms are not completely understood.Here,we demonstrated that serum LPS levels were significantly higher in newly diagnosed diabetic patients than in normal control.miR-145 level in peripheral blood mononuclear cells decreased in type 2 diabetics.LPS repressed the transcription of miR-143/145 cluster and decreased miR-145 levels.Attenuation of miR-145 activity by anti-miR-145 triggered liver inflammation and increased serum chemokines in C57BL/6 J mice.Conversely,lentivirus-mediated miR-145 overexpression inhibited macrophage infiltration,reduced body weight,and improved glucose metabolism in db/db mice.And miR-145 overexpression markedly reduced plaque size in the aorta in ApoE−/−mice.Both OPG and KLF5 were targets of miR-145.miR-145 repressed cell proliferation and induced apoptosis partially by targeting OPG and KLF5.miR-145 also suppressed NF-κB activation by targeting OPG and KLF5.Our findings provide an association of the environment with the progress of metabolic disorders.Increasing miR-145 may be a new potential therapeutic strategy in preventing and treating metabolic diseases such as type 2 diabetes and atherosclerosis. | Min He Nan Wu Man Cheong Leong Weiwei Zhang Zi Ye Rumei Li Jinyang Huang Zhaoyun Zhang Lianxi Li Xiao Yao Wenbai Zhou Naijia Liu Zhihong Yang Xuehong Dong Yintao Li Lili Chen Qin Li Xuanchun Wang Jie Wen Xiaolong Zhao Bin Lu Yehong Yang Qinghua Wang Renming Hu | 2020 | Journal of Molecular Cell Biology2020,12,2: | 7 |
| 3 | Association between socioeconomic status and chronic obstructive pulmonary disease in Jiangsu province, China: a population-based study显示文摘Background:Chronic obstructive pulmonary disease(COPD)is a common public health problem worldwide.Recent studies have reported that socioeconomic status(SES)is related to the incidence of COPD.This study aimed to investigate the association between SES and COPD among adults in Jiangsu province,China,and to determine the possible direct and indirect effects of SES on the morbidity of COPD.Methods:A cross-sectional study was conducted among adults aged 40 years and above between May and December of 2015 in Jiangsu province,China.Participants were selected using a multistage sampling approach.COPD,the outcome variable,was diagnosed by physicians based on spirometry,respiratory symptoms,and risk factors.Education,occupation,and monthly family average income(FAI)were used to separately indicate SES as the explanatory variable.Mixed-effects logistic regression models were introduced to calculate odds ratios(ORs)and 95%confidence intervals(CIs)for examining the SES-COPD relationship.A pathway analysis was conducted to further explore the pulmonary function impairment of patients with different SES.Results:The mean age of the 2421 participants was 56.63±9.62 years.The prevalence of COPD was 11.8%(95%CI:10.5%–13.1%)among the overall sample population.After adjustment for age,gender,residence,outdoor and indoor air pollution,body weight status,cigarette smoking,and potential study area-level clustering effects,educational attainment was negatively associated with COPD prevalence in men;white collars were at lower risk(OR:0.60,95%CI:0.43–0.83)of experiencing COPD than blue collars;compared with those within the lower FAI subgroup,participants in the upper(OR:0.68,95%CI:0.49–0.97)tertiles were less likely to experience COPD.Such negative associations between all these three SES indicators and COPD were significant among men only.Education,FAI,and occupation had direct or indirect effects on pulmonary function including post-bronchodilator forced expiratory volume in 1 s/forced vital capacity(FEV1/FVC),FEV1,FVC,and FEV1 percentage of predicted.Education,FAI,and occupation had indirect effects on pulmonary function indices of all participants mainly through smoking status,indoor air pollution,and outdoor air pollution.We also found that occupation could affect post-bronchodilator FEV1/FVC through body mass index.Conclusions:Education,occupation,and FAI had an adverse relationship with COPD prevalence in Jiangsu province,China.SES has both direct and indirect associations with pulmonary function impairment.SES is of great significance for COPD morbidity.It is important that population-based COPD prevention strategies should be tailored for people with different SES. | Dan-Dan Zhang Jian-Nan Liu Qing Ye Zi Chen Ling Wu Xue-Qing Peng Gan Lu Jin-Yi Zhou Ran Tao Zhen Ding Fei Xu Linfu Zhou | 2021 | Chinese Medical Journal2021,,13: | 5 |

| 5 | A novel approach for designing efficient broadband photodetectors expanding from deep ultraviolet to near infrared显示文摘Broadband photodetection(PD)covering the deep ultraviolet to near-infrared(200–1000 nm)range is significant and desirable for various optoelectronic designs.Herein,we employ ultraviolet(UV)luminescent concentrators(LC),iodinebased perovskite quantum dots(PQDs),and organic bulk heterojunction(BHJ)as the UV,visible,and near-infrared(NIR)photosensitive layers,respectively,to construct a broadband heterojunction PD.Firstly,experimental and theoretical results reveal that optoelectronic properties and stability of CsPbI3 PQDs are significantly improved through Er3+doping,owing to the reduced defect density,improved charge mobility,increased formation energy,tolerance factor,etc.The narrow bandgap of CsPbI3:Er3+PQDs serves as a visible photosensitive layer of PD.Secondly,considering the matchable energy bandgap,the BHJ(BTP-4Cl:PBDB-TF)is selected as to NIR absorption layer to fabricate the hybrid structure with CsPbI3:Er3+PQDs.Thirdly,UV LC converts the UV light(200–400 nm)to visible light(400–700 nm),which is further absorbed by CsPbI3:Er3+PQDs.In contrast with other perovskites PDs and commercial Si PDs,our PD presents a relatively wide response range and high detectivity especially in UV and NIR regions(two orders of magnitude increase that of commercial Si PDs).Furthermore,the PD also demonstrates significantly enhanced air-and UV-stability,and the photocurrent of the device maintains 81.5%of the original one after 5000 cycles.This work highlights a new attempt for designing broadband PDs,which has application potential in optoelectronic devices. | Nan Ding Yanjie Wu Wen Xu Jiekai Lyu Yue Wang Lu Zi Long Shao Rui Sun Nan Wang Sen Liu Donglei Zhou Xue Bai Ji Zhou Hongwei Song | 2022 | Light(Science & Applications)2022,11,5: | 5 |
| 6 | Spatial-temporal Evolution Characteristics and Decoupling Analysis of Influencing Factors of China’s Aviation Carbon Emissions显示文摘The aviation industry has become one of the top ten greenhouse gas emission industries in the world. China’s aviation carbon emissions continue to increase, but the analysis of its influencing factors at the provincial level is still incomplete. This paper firstly uses Stochastic Impacts by Regression on Population, Affluence and Technology model(STIRPAT) model to analyze the time series evolution of China’s aviation carbon emissions from 2000 to 2019. Secondly, it uses the Logarithmic Mean Divisia Index(LDMI) model to analyze the influencing characteristics and degree of four factors on China’s aviation carbon emissions, which are air transportation revenue, aviation route structure, air transportation intensity and aviation energy intensity. Thirdly, it determines the various factors’ influencing direction and evolution trend of 31 provinces’ aviation carbon emissions in China(not including Hong Kong, Macao, Taiwan of China due to incomplete data). Finally, it derives the decoupling effort model and analyzes the decoupling relationship and decoupling effort degree between air carbon emissions and air transportation revenue in different provinces. The study found that from 2000 to2019, China’s total aviation carbon emissions continued to grow, while the growth rate of aviation carbon emissions showed a fluctuating downward trend. Air transportation revenue and aviation route structure promote the growth of total aviation carbon emissions, and air transportation intensity and aviation energy intensity have a restraining effect on the growth of total aviation carbon emissions. The scope of negative driving effect of air transportation revenue and air transportation intensity on total aviation carbon emissions in various provinces has increased. While the scope of positive driving influence of aviation route structure on total aviation carbon emissions of various provinces has increased, aviation energy intensity mainly has negative driving influence on total aviation carbon emissions of each province. Overall, the emission reduction trend in the areas to the west and north of the Qinling-Huaihe River Line is obvious. The decoupling mode between air carbon emissions and air transportation revenue in 31 provinces is mainly expansion negative decoupling.The air transportation intensity effect shows strong decoupling efforts in most provinces, the decoupling effort of aviation route structure effect and aviation energy intensity effect is not prominent. | HAN Ruiling LI Lingling ZHANG Xiaoyan LU Zi ZHU Shaohua | 2022 | Chinese Geographical Science2022,32,2: | 5 |

| 11 | Life History Recorded in the Vagino-cervical Microbiome Along with Multi-omes显示文摘The vagina contains at least a billion microbial cells,dominated by lactobacilli.Here we perform metagenomic shotgun sequencing on cervical and fecal samples from a cohort of 516 Chinese women of reproductive age,as well as cervical,fecal,and salivary samples from a second cohort of 632 women.Factors such as pregnancy history,delivery history,cesarean section,and breastfeeding were all more important than menstrual cycle in shaping the microbiome,and such information would be necessary before trying to interpret differences between vagino-cervical microbiome data.Greater proportion of Bifidobacterium breve was seen with older age at sexual debut.The relative abundance of lactobacilli especially Lactobacillus crispatus was negatively associated with pregnancy history.Potential markers for lack of menstrual regularity,heavy flow,dysmenorrhea,and contraceptives were also identified.Lactobacilli were rare during breastfeeding or post-menopause.Other features such as mood fluctuations and facial speckles could potentially be predicted from the vagino-cervical microbiome.Gut and salivary microbiomes,plasma vitamins,metals,amino acids,and hormones showed associations with the vagino-cervical microbiome.Our results offer an unprecedented glimpse into the microbiota of the female reproductive tract and call for international collaborations to better understand its long-term health impact other than in the settings of infection or pre-term birth. | Zhuye Jie Chen Chen Lilan Hao Fei Li Liju Song Xiaowei Zhang Jie Zhu Liu Tian Xin Tong Kaiye Cai Zhe Zhang Yanmei Ju Xinlei Yu Ying Li Hongcheng Zhou Haorong Lu Xuemei Qiu Qiang Li Yunli Liao Dongsheng Zhou Heng Lian Yong Zuo Xiaomin Chen Weiqiao Rao Yan Ren Yuan Wang Jin Zi Rong Wang Na Liu Jinghua Wu Wei Zhang Xiao Liu Yang Zong Weibin Liu Liang Xiao Yong Hou Xun Xu Huanming Yang Jian Wang Karsten Kristiansen Huijue Jia | 2022 | Genomics, Proteomics & Bioinformatics2022,20,2: | 2 |

| 19 | Aerodynamic characteristics of morphing wing withflexible leading-edge显示文摘The morphing wing can improve the flight performance during different phases.However,research has been subject to limitations in aerodynamic characteristics of the morphing wing with a flexible leading-edge.The computational fluid dynamic method and dynamic mesh were used to simulate the continuous morphing of the flexible leading-edge.After comparing the steady aerodynamic characteristics of morphing and conventional wings,this study examined the unsteady aerodynamic characteristics of morphing wings with upward and downward deflections of the leading-edge at different frequencies.The numerical results show that for the steady aerodynamic,the leading-edge deflection mainly affects the stall characteristic.The downward deflection of the leading-edge increases the stall angle of attack and nose-down pitching moment.The results are opposite for the upward deflection.For the unsteady aerodynamic,at a small angle of attack,the transient lift coefficient of the upward deflection,growing with the increase of deflection frequency,is larger than that of the static case.The transient lift coefficient of the downward deflection,decreasing with the increase of deflection frequency,is smaller than that of the static case.However,at a large angle of attack,an opposite effect of deflection frequency on the transient lift coefficient was demonstrated.The transient lift coefficient is larger than that of the static case when the leading edge is in the nose-up stage,and lower than that of the static one in the nose-down stage. | Zi KAN Daochun LI Tong SHEN Jinwu XIANG Lu ZHANG | 2020 | Chinese Journal of Aeronautics2020,33,10: | 1 |
